## Releases

MergeKite dedupes customer records nightly; releases ship the matcher config and the scoring model together. Never deploy one without the other — mismatched versions cause false merges in the Brillo tenant. Cut a release from `stable`, tag it, and run `kite verify` before pushing to the Oxfell registry. If verification fails, page the data-integrity rotation, not platform. Rollback is tag-based and takes under two minutes. All release artifacts must be signed with the key below.

signing key of kagaf-fahap = bky3_CfS

Priya — cooler transport for the Askwelt field clinic. Three vaccine coolers packed, loggers armed, ice packs swapped at 07:10. Transit window is six hours max, so the Redmile courier must leave by 09:00 sharp. Paperwork is in the sleeve on cooler 1; clinic copy inside, our copy stays here. Don't let anyone open the lids for inspection. One confidential instruction governs the hand-over and it is appended directly below.

handover note for yagef-bagep: the drudor pelius courier leaves the kasdor zorvan norir ledger at gate 8016 under passcode 755406

/*
 * FLEET_FUEL_REPORT_WINDOW_DAYS
 *
 * Heads up, support folks: this constant controls how far back the
 * Haulwright fleet fuel-usage report looks. Customers who complain
 * about "missing trucks" in the report almost always have vehicles
 * idle longer than this window — check that first before escalating.
 * Don't bump it past 90 without asking the data team; the Brindlemoor
 * warehouse queries get slow fast. The build token this value shipped
 * under is recorded on the next line.
 */

session token of yahof-bajeg = htk9_0d43d44ed

Handover — Quillbeam ingest handlers

Welcome aboard. Cold starts on the ingest tier spike after each deploy; Marek and I mitigated this with provisioned concurrency plus a keepalive pinger, but it's tuned per region and fragile. Don't raise memory without checking the warm-pool math first — we burned a week on that. The pinger lives in the ops repo under /warmers. If latency alarms fire within ten minutes of a release, it's almost always cold starts. Current settings are:

settings of bafof-fajog:
[aldix]
port = 9300
region = north-3
host = aldix.kelvilabs.example
team = istath
timeout_ms = 1500
retries = 8